We all have a story to tell. Sometimes that story is repressed for years before we are ready to tell it. Sometimes our stories are hidden because they are forgotten, or diminished. Thania Petersen has two bodies of work at the AVA Gallery this week that begin to tell her story.I am Royal and Barbie and Me explore cultural, political and religious identity while examining how history weaves itself into our present.
